    Catalogue# : 18
    Retaliatory Postage Due 1882: 25 st. deep blue & blue, single example used on 1887 cover from Kazanlik to Constantinople tied POSTE KAZANLUK Eastern Rumelian datestamp in blue (27/IV). Ottoman 'T' marking on front and taxed on arrival in Constantinople with Turkey 1884 1 pi. blue (Mi. 84) tied by blue 'Constantinople / Arrivee' datestamp (May 12, gregorian). A fresh and fine cover.

    Note: Turkish-Bulgarian War. Differences regarding the Topkhane Convention of April 5, 1886 led to Ottoman Turkey refusing to accept mail from the the former South Bulgaria as valid, and for several years such mail was taxed on arrival.
